Aveeno Baby Products and Clinical Benefits

Aveeno Baby represents a significant portion of the brand's offerings, with products specifically formulated for infant sensitive skin. According to professional resources, the Aveeno Baby line is designed to address various skin conditions from daily care to more serious concerns like eczema. The products utilize natural oat extract known to soothe and gently nourish delicate skin.

The Aveeno Baby line includes several key products:

  • Aveeno Baby Eczema Therapy Nighttime Balm: Formulated with ceramides and non-greasy glycerin to moisturize throughout the night. Clinical data suggests this product helped achieve a 51% reduction in EASI (Eczema Area and Severity Index) scores at day 71 in a study of patients aged 6 to 47 months with mild to moderate atopic dermatitis.

  • Aveeno Baby Eczema Therapy Moisturizing Cream: Features a Triple Oat Formula with ceramides and panthenol to relieve dry, itchy, and irritated skin due to eczema. This product is noted to be compatible with prescription therapies.

  • Aveeno Baby 2-in-1 Bath Wash and Shampoo: Designed to cleanse baby's delicate hair and skin, this product is described as mild, gentle, pH-balanced, sulfate-free, soap-free, hypoallergenic, and tear-free.

Clinical studies referenced in professional materials indicate that atopic dermatitis (eczema) affects up to 25% of children, most commonly appearing first between 3 and 6 months of age. Moisturizers that soothe, protect, and restore the skin barrier are considered a first-line treatment for this condition. The clinical data suggests that Aveeno Baby Eczema Therapy products may offer significant benefits, including a reported 72% improvement in quality of life scores at 12 weeks and a 39% reduction in corticosteroid usage.

The Science Behind Aveeno Formulations

Aveeno's product development is rooted in the science of colloidal oat, which has been recognized for its skin-soothing properties for decades. The company has utilized this ingredient for more than 60 years, innovating to unlock its power for relieving, restoring, and protecting sensitive skin.

Colloidal oat is carefully selected from nature's botanicals and uniquely formulated through scientific processes to deliver visible benefits for skin health. In Aveeno Baby products specifically, colloidal oat is incorporated into formulas designed to support the baby's natural skin barrier, which serves as their defense against external irritants and germs. Some formulations are even inspired by vernix, the protective coating on newborns, to provide nourishing care for newborn skin from day one.
